Step 1
Preheat oven to 400 degrees. Prepare a cooking sheet with parchment paper. Set aside.
Step 2
Put 4-5 cups of water in a 10-inch skillet and add the baking soda. Bring water to a boil.
Step 3
While water is coming to a boil use a pizza cutter, knife, or kitchen sheers to cut the biscuits into 9 pieces.
Step 4
Next, place 9-12 pieces in the boiling water for 15-20 seconds. Try to make sure they get fully submerged or flip them so all sides get coated in the baking soda water.
Step 5
Remove the pretzel bites quickly with a slotted spoon and place them on the prepared cooking sheet, making sure the pieces are not overlapping and not touching each other, if possible. Then sprinkle them with coarse sea salt.
Step 6
Repeat until all have gone in the boiling water bath.
Step 7
Next, bake pretzel bites at 400 degrees for 11-15 minutes.
Step 8
Remove from oven, and enjoy plain or dip in cheese sauce, mustard, or your favorite pretzel dip.
Step 9
Enjoy!
